Output 84472f576fd91726d75e7ab0a65598f6826cfaedd5f095d74951042fdea5a1c4:0

value
197381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e518049b251b234d850ea5660b7d97740c0ba8 OP_EQUAL
address
323cPqVheXiBghwZ8JEVSmjFNQ1qDqWYpF
transaction
84472f576fd91726d75e7ab0a65598f6826cfaedd5f095d74951042fdea5a1c4
confirmations
110979
spent
true